Lances are hollow steel bars which can resist very high temperatures. They are used to introduce additional elements into the melting vessel after it has been charged with its principal raw materials. In both types of steelmaking, a lance is principally used to inject oxygen into the melt. This is essential in BOF steelmaking to achieve the chemical conversion of iron into steel, whereas in EAFs, oxygen injection is more usually associated with generating additional energy in the melt to reduce electricity consumption.
Large diameter pipes are at least 10 inches or greater so will invariably be welded rather than seamless due to its larger size. The pipe can be produced by longitudinal or spiral welding for applications that often include gas and oil transport.

LCO (Lithium cobalt oxide), sometimes called lithium cobaltate or lithium cobaltite, is a chemical compound with formula LiCoO. Lithium cobalt oxide is a dark blue or bluish-gray crystalline solid, and is commonly used in the positive electrodes of lithium-ion batteries.

Lead is added to steel to enhance its machinability, and is a key feature of premium low-carbon free-cutting (free-machining) steels. Lead’s much lower melting point and the fact that it is insoluble in steel, means that during machining it melts and forms a lubricating layer at the point of contact between machining tool and the steel being turned, milled or drilled. This lubrication allows faster machining through higher rotational and material feed speeds, and enhances cutting tool life. The lead in the steel also helps reduce deformation stresses.
Low emission vehicles are light duty passenger vehicles meeting strict emissions regulations in California. These can be divided into a number of sub-categories including ultra-low emissions vehicles(ULEV),super-ultra-low emissions vehicles(SULEV), partial zero emissions vehicles(PZEV) or zero emission vehicles(ZEV).
The lithium iron phosphate battery or LFP battery, is a type of lithium-ion battery using lithium iron phosphate as the cathode material, and a graphitic carbon electrode with a metallic backing as the anode. LiFePO4 batteries are comparable to sealed lead acid batteries and are often being touted as a drop-in replacement for lead acid applications. This battery chemistry is targeted for use in power tools, electric vehicles, solar energy installations and more recently large grid-scale energy storage.

Along with iron ore and coke, limestone is an important ingredient in blast furnace ironmaking. The function of limestone is to react with impurities introduced by the other two ingredients to form a slag which can be removed from the furnace without contaminating the iron. The heat inside the blast furnace converts limestone into calcium oxide and CO2 gas. Calcium oxide readily reacts with impurities like silica, sulphur, alumina and magnesia to form a slag. This gradually filters down through the furnace to settle on top of the liquid iron where it can be tapped off.

This is a natural gas (predominantly methane, CH4) that has been converted to liquid form for ease of storage or transport. Liquefied natural gas takes up about 1/600th the volume of natural gas in the gaseous state. It is odourless, colourless, non-toxic and non-corrosive.
Light hydrocarbon material, gaseous at atmospheric temperature and pressure, held in the liquid state by pressure to facilitate storage, transport and handling. Commercial liquefied gas consists essentially of either propane or butane, or mixtures thereof.
